For 18-years, Post Protector has provided simple, slide-on barrier protection for in-ground posts. It works in conjunction with the chemical preservative as an important additional layer of protection against soil-dwelling and atmospheric decay fungi and insect infestation. Its first important to understand decay. Many believe that moisture CAUSES decay. Moisture is not the cause of decay but is 1 of 3 conditions needed for decay to occur. The conditions: 1 Moisture, 2 Oxygen and 3 Suitable temperature. These conditions enable the soil-dwelling or atmospheric decay fungi, as well as termites and other subterranean insects, to feed on the wood fiber. So the Decay/Degradation of ground-contact wood is not CAUSED by moisture but by the action of wood destroying organisms feeding on the wood. The chemical preservatives protection strategy is to poison the wood fiber, rendering it an unsuitable food source for the wood destroying organisms. The downside to that approach is that all chemical preservatives eventually lose resistance to decay and insect infestation. Post Protector becomes the perfect complement to the pressure treated (or cedar) post by simply providing a physical barrier isolating the post so the wood-destroying organisms have NO access to the post.

Q:If these fill with water I don?t understand how they are expected to prevent decay. Drilling holes seems like it would defeat the purpose, but also if they?re not caulked on the top side, and they fill with water- won?t the wood rot and attract pests?
by|Jan 28, 2023
1 Answer
Answer This Question

A:  There are weep holes at the bottom of the Post Protectors that release moisture into the inactive soil 24-36" down. Decay only happens in active/live soil near ground level and down 12" usually. Please see the attached pic for the detail
